在C#中,我们通常使用ASP.NET MVC或ASP.NET Core MVC来构建Web应用程序。要在这些应用程序中结合jQuery实现动态效果,你需要遵循以下步骤:
Views
文件夹下的.cshtml
文件)中,引入jQuery库。你可以使用CDN或者下载到本地并引用。<!DOCTYPE html>
<html>
<head>
<title>My App</title>
<!-- 引入jQuery库 -->
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<!-- 页面内容 -->
</body>
</html>
<div id="myDiv">这里是内容</div>
<script>
标签中或者单独的JavaScript文件中编写jQuery代码,实现动态效果。例如,当点击按钮时,改变div的内容。 $(document).ready(function() {
$("#myButton").click(function() {
$("#myDiv").text("内容已更改");
});
});
</script>
public class HomeController : Controller
{
public ActionResult GetData()
{
// 获取数据
string data = "服务器返回的数据";
return Json(data, JsonRequestBehavior.AllowGet);
}
}
$(document).ready(function() {
$("#myButton").click(function() {
$.ajax({
url: "/Home/GetData",
type: "GET",
dataType: "json",
success: function(data) {
$("#myDiv").text(data);
},
error: function() {
alert("获取数据失败");
}
});
});
});
</script>
这样,你就可以在C#中结合jQuery实现动态效果了。请根据你的需求调整HTML元素、jQuery代码和C#控制器。